CI note for GrowCell maintainers: the nightly suite keeps flagging sensor drift in the humidity loop, but it's usually not the hardware. The Leafline simulator seeds its calibration table from wall-clock time, so runs that straddle midnight get a skewed baseline and the controller over-corrects. Quick fix: pin the sim clock in the job config before retrying. If drift persists after that, actually check the mock sensor firmware version. The trace token from the last clean run is pasted below for comparison.

pipeline stamp: htk3_69f

## Step 4: Point FeedLint at the new validator cluster

Welcome aboard! This is the step folks usually trip on. FeedLint, our podcast feed validator, used to run as a cron job on the old Bramblewood box, but it's now a proper service behind the gateway. You'll need to swap out the legacy settings in your local env before the enclosure checks will pass. Don't copy from an old teammate's setup — half of those are stale. Use exactly these configuration values:

settings of tagef-bawif:
DRUIX_HOST=druix.zemvarlabs.internal
DRUIX_PORT=8000

## Environment Variables: Resolver Workaround

Heads up for review: the Bramblewick workers were hitting flaky DNS inside the Opaline cluster — lookups for the token service would intermittently time out, so we pinned a retrying resolver via env config rather than patching the base image. `BW_RESOLVER_RETRIES=3` and `BW_RESOLVER_TIMEOUT_MS=800` cover the flapping. The resolver also authenticates to our internal DNS-over-TLS endpoint, which is why there's a credential in this file at all. That credential is set on the following line:

env line for yahip-tafog: RELAY_SECRET3=4ca

# ---------------------------------------------------------
# Rollout knobs for the Lanternjaw flag framework.
# If a flag ramp goes sideways at 3am, these are the dials
# you want. Bumping the ramp step too high has bitten us
# before — go slow and watch the Brindlemoor error board.
# The current tuning constants follow below.
# ---------------------------------------------------------

tuning constants:
QUOTAS = {
    "druwyn": 5,
    "holix": 5,
    "zorath": 5,
    "holwyn": 10,
}